Birth Injury

Children who have cerebral palsy are able to receive therapy, medication, or surgery to enhance their quality of life. They will depend on their family members for support throughout their lives. Cerebral palsy may be the result of a birth defect or medical negligence, like hypoxia or other types of brain damage during labor and birth. A lawyer can aid families in seeking financial compensation for the CP treatment of their child.

The attorneys of a company that handles birth injury cases analyze the facts of each case and determine which healthcare providers may have committed errors. They interview witnesses and review medical records, including fetal monitoring strips, head image tests, and other evidence like photographs and prenatal records. The lawyers will be able to determine if the delivery was rushed and if the child was required forceps or vacuum extraction as well as other factors.

The lawyers calculate a settlement amount considering all the tangible and intangible damages that the family has endured since the child's diagnosis. This includes the cost of medication, assistive devices and mobility aids, special education surgeries, transport equipment, as well as occupational, physical and speech therapies. The lawyers will also seek compensation for the emotional, vimeo.Com physical and financial strains that come when dealing with the child's illness. They can also file a lawsuit in order for an equitable financial award in an appeal.

Statute of Limitations

If a doctor or medical professional causes injury that leads to a birth defect such as cerebral palsy or other neurological disorder, the victim may file a medical malpractice lawsuit against them. These lawsuits seek compensation for the medical expenses incurred by the child in the past as well as in the future, as well as any other damages.

When the time is right to file a lawsuit, the family must act fast. Every state has a statute of limitation that establishes the deadline by which an action can be filed. Once the time limit expires the potential plaintiff will lose the right to sue the medical professionals responsible for their child's injury.

A lawyer with cerebral palsy can assist you in filing an application before the time limit expires. Additionally, a lawyer can help the family gather the evidence to show that the child's disability was due to medical negligence.

Once the initial medical legal review has been completed A cerebral palsy lawyer will draft an official demand note to the defendants requesting for compensation from the victims for their losses. They will then conduct more research and gather additional evidence to prove that the injury resulted from an error in medicine.
